Recreation Therapist

Recreation Therapist
Duties and Responsibilities:
The recreational therapists plan, direct, and coordinate recreation-based treatment program for people with disabilities, injuries, or illnesses.  They use a variety of modalities including arts and crafts, drama, music, dance, sports, games, and community reintegration field trips; they use the field trips to help maintain a patient’s physical, social, and emotional well-being. Some duties that the recreation therapist does are:
·         Evaluating interventions for effectiveness
·         Help patients learn social skills needed to become or remain independent
·         Record and analyze a patient’s progress
·         Engage the patients in therapeutic activities, such as games
Salary: $42,280 per year   $20.33 per hour
Education:
Most therapists need a bachelor’s degree in recreational therapy. Some recreational therapists can get an associate’s degree, master’s, or a doctoral degree. Courses include assessment, human anatomy, medical and psychiatric terminology, characterizes of disabilities, and the use of assistive devices and technology. A bachelor’s degree program usually includes an internship.

X-Ray Technician

X-Ray Technician
Duties and Responsibilities:
The x-ray technicians use x-ray machine, ultrasound machines, magnetic resonance scanners, and etc. other advanced machines to help treat illnesses and injuries under the permission of the physician. They are responsible for getting patients ready for radiological tests and treatments that will be performed on the patient. They place the equipment at a correct angle and distance from the patients to make images for the physician. They can also assist the physicians in performing procedures to help the patients. They must also make sure that the equipment is properly maintained. They work in hospitals, clinics, medical laboratories, nursing homes, and in private industries.
Salary: $24,000-$36,000
Education:
Students should take math, science and English in high school. In order for students to become an X-Ray Technician they must complete a two year training program in a hospital or school. A high school diploma or a GED is required for these programs.

Radiation Therapist


Radiation Therapist
Thinkquest.org
Duties and Responsibilities:
The radiation therapy technologists assist the radiologists and the oncologists (cancer specialists) in treating the diseases by exposing areas of the patients’ body. They are also responsible with helping with the treatments, maintaining the radiation equipment, and helping with the patient records. They work in hospitals, public health clinics, cancer treatment centers, and private offices.
Salary: $22,000-$36,000
Education:
Students should take calluses in science, math, and English that are available in high school. Students can come train in a one-year or a two-year program. The one-year programs are offered at hospitals. To be in a one year program the applicant must have graduated from an approved program in radiologic technology or been a nurse with the education of radiation physics. For a two-year program you must have a GED or a high school diploma to be entered

Psychologist

Psychologist
Duties and Responsibilities:
The psychologists study the behavior and the actions of people to understand and change their behavior patterns. They provide counseling to those with emotional, learning, and behavioral problems. They work in schools, clinics, hospitals, and a private practice. They specialize in education, clinical, etc. psychology. Their duties include:
  • Diagnosing problems
  • Interviewing the patients
  • Develop and select the administering tests
  • Counsel patients and their families
  • Conduct research.
Salary: $45,000-$65,000
Education:
Students should prepare for the career in psychology by taking the most challenging (AP or IB) high school courses in AP or IB classes in English and science. Licensed psychologists must earn a Ph.D. in psychology. Clinical psychologists need to complete a two-year internship after earning their doctorate degree and pass oral/written state qualifying exams. School psychologists must earn at least a master's degree.
